Myelofibrosis

Myelofibrosis is a rare type of chronic blood cancer and bone marrow disorder in which excessive scar tissue gradually replaces healthy bone marrow. This scarring disrupts the normal production of red blood cells, white blood cells, and platelets, leading to anemia, infections, and abnormal bleeding. The condition may develop on its own, known as primary myelofibrosis, or occur as a complication of other blood disorders such as polycythemia vera or essential thrombocythemia.

Common symptoms include persistent fatigue, weakness, shortness of breath, easy bruising, night sweats, fever, weight loss, bone pain, and a feeling of fullness caused by an enlarged spleen. Diagnosis involves blood tests, bone marrow biopsy, genetic mutation testing, and imaging studies. Mutations in genes such as JAK2, CALR, or MPL are frequently associated with the disease.

Options include targeted therapies, blood transfusions, medications to improve blood counts, chemotherapy, and supportive care. In selected patients, stem cell transplantation offers the only potential cure but carries significant risks. Early diagnosis, regular monitoring, and personalized treatment can improve quality of life and help manage complications associated with myelofibrosis.
